To solve the factored quadratic equation \((13x + 3)(9x - 14) = 0\), we can set each factor to zero and solve for \(x\).

  1. Set the first factor to zero: \[ 13x + 3 = 0 \] Subtract 3 from both sides: \[ 13x = -3 \] Now, divide by 13: \[ x = -\frac{3}{13} \]

  2. Set the second factor to zero: \[ 9x - 14 = 0 \] Add 14 to both sides: \[ 9x = 14 \] Now, divide by 9: \[ x = \frac{14}{9} \]

Thus, the solution set is: \[ x = \left{ -\frac{3}{13}, \frac{14}{9} \right} \]
